About Jaclene
Clients work with Jaclene to address issues that show up as stress, depression, addiction, parenting struggles, bipolar mood concerns, ADHD, intimacy and attachment difficulties, and many forms of grief and life transition. Her approach is trauma-informed and eclectic - she is trained in EMDR, Brainspotting, and c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), and she integrates Gottman methods for couples work alongside art and music therapy, somatic techniques, and inner child work. Those elements are woven together to match each person’s needs rather than following a one-size-fits-all plan.
In sessions Jaclene focuses on attentive listening and relational attunement, noticing not just words but the story underneath them. She helps clients set compassionate, realistic goals that reflect deeper values and long-term hopes - for example, shifting patterns in relationships, softening physical tension, or discovering new ways of being in the world. Many people find they’re able to begin again with gentler, steadier steps when they work with her.
Jaclene’s path into therapy started with a childhood gift - a book about a quiet psychotherapist who helped others through pain. That early inspiration grew into a professional commitment: to offer steady presence, skillful care, and a belief in the possibility of change for those who are weary, tender-hearted, or feeling lost.
Therapeutic approaches for online healing
Jaclene often draws on Attachment-Based Therapy to explore how early relationships shape current patterns - this approach helps people understand intimacy, trust, and relational wounds so they can build more secure connections. She also uses Client-Centered Therapy, which emphasizes empathy, acceptance, and a collaborative pace so clients feel met and understood while they discover their own solutions.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is another tool she applies to help identify unhelpful thoughts and behaviors and develop practical strategies for reducing anxiety, depressive symptoms, and stress.
Finding the right approach is part of the work. Jaclene collaborates with each person to determine which methods fit their goals, preferences, and life circumstances, adjusting the blend of techniques as progress unfolds.
